We are looking for an experienced engineer with exposure to testing on switches and routers. Job Responsibilities: 1. Design and implement test scenarios (automated and/or manual) for specific features supported by ethernet switches.
2. Work with design, architecture and SW teams to understand, and characterise ethernet/networking protocols and features. 3. Creation and review of test strategies, test plans/cases, and test automation. 4. Interactions with other teams and customers for demos, test qualifications, and feedback sessions. 5. Work with existing test infrastructure and develop additional tools/modules (TCL or Python) as needed in the linux environment.
Requirements : 1. BE/BTech (ECE or CS) with at least 7 years of L2/L3/L4 protocol test development experience in the networking domain. 2. Excellent scripting skills (TCL/python). Ability to build modular functions/scripts. 3. Exposure to basic C (ability to understand API call sequences). 4. Excellent analytical problem solving skills. Ability to root-cause issues and propose solutions. 5. Familiarity with tools such as scapy/ wireshark/ ixia/ spirent/ iperf/ git/ Jira/Jenkins (API based approaches preferred over GUI). 6. Exposure to telemetry features (networking metadata, traffic analysis, IPFIX) would be a plus. 7. CCNA level of networking knowledge is minimum. CCNP certification is a plus.
8. An understanding of OS basics (unix/linux, kernel, RTOS) would be a plus.
Job Classification
Industry: Software ProductFunctional Area / Department: Engineering - Software & QA, Role Category: Quality Assurance and TestingRole: Post Silicon Test EngineerEmployement Type: Full time